Neonatal Care (Leave and Pay) Act

Bliss has campaigned for and supported a new entitlement to additional paid leave from work when a baby is in neonatal care, which is available to qualifying parents whose baby is born on or after 6 April 2025 who have spent 7 full days or more on the unit.

Both parents are allowed up to 12 weeks of paid leave, in addition to other leave entitlements such as maternity and paternity leave.

Neonatal leave is available to employees from their first day in a new job and applies to both parents of babies who are admitted into hospital up to the age of 28 days, and who have a continuous stay in hospital of 7 full days or more.
